Dubai / Travel Information / Currency


The basic monetary unit of UAE is the Dirham (Dh). The paper currency comes in denominations of 500, 200, 100, 50, 10, 5 and coins in Dh 1 and fils 50, 25, 10 and 5. A Dirham is divided into 100 fils.

There are no restrictions on import and export of both local and foreign currencies. Hotel bills can be paid in cash, travellers cheques or credit cards.
